2. Air Heat Exchanger/Radiator: The Pinnacle of Heat Exchange Technology
This advanced heat exchanger efficiently cools or heats air using media such as water, glycol solution, steam, or heat conduction oil. Selection of the appropriate model is crucial to match the specific working conditions for optimal performance.
Our Air Heat Exchanger is elegantly divided into: Air Heater, and Air Cooler, each engineered to deliver unparalleled thermal management solutions..
The versatile Air Heater boasts multiple configurations, including electric heating, steam heating, and oil heating, providing tailored solutions for diverse industrial applications.
3. Economizer
Product Description:
An economizer is a highly efficient device positioned at the lower end of a boiler's tail flue, ingeniously designed to capture and recycle the potentially wasted heat from exhaust gases. It adeptly transforms boiler feedwater into a saturated state by utilizing the steam drum's pressure, thus significantly lowering the exhaust gas temperature and promoting exceptional energy conservation and efficiency.
The robust steel tube economizer, renowned for its pressure tolerance, can function as a boiling type. Crafted generally from carbon steel pipes with diameters ranging from 32 to 51 millimeters, the efficiency of heat transfer is further amplified by optional fins. This sophisticated system comprises horizontally aligned parallel elbow pipes, commonly referred to as serpentine pipes.
Product Advantages:
1. Efficiently captures heat from low-temperature flue gases, resulting in reduced exhaust temperatures, minimized exhaust losses, and significant fuel conservation.
2. By pre-heating feedwater in the economizer before it reaches the steam drum, the absorption on the heating surface is minimized, allowing the economizer to replace some costlier evaporative heating surfaces, optimizing cost-efficiency.
3. The increased water temperature entering the steam drum mitigates the wall temperature difference, thereby reducing thermal stress and extending the steam drum's operational lifespan.
Product Usage:
During the critical start-up phase of a drum boiler, the absence of circulation in the steam water pipeline causes the economizer's water to stagnate. As combustion intensifies and flue gas temperature rises, the risk of water vaporization becomes imminent, potentially overheating localized sections of the economizer. To counteract this, a recirculation pipeline from the steam drum's centralized drainage pipe to the economizer's inlet is essential, ensuring dynamic water flow and preventing vaporization.
Production Process: Finned Tube Type
Strategically positioned at the tail of the boiler where flue gas temperature is lower, the economizer excels in:
(1) Capturing heat from low-temperature flue gases in the tail flue, thereby reducing exhaust temperatures, enhancing thermal efficiency of low parameter boilers, and conserving fuel.
(2) Raising the temperature of water entering the drum, which lowers the temperature differential between the drum wall and feed water, thus minimizing thermal stress and extending the drum's lifespan.
